Output 6e666fb26a92c212dfdfd084da8806213fd3c419043d3eaa615eae9475e77fea:122

value
432120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a34684452a79dbf61a6827a1e1bc87326a1448a0 OP_EQUAL
address
3GaLYPydXWreYP8y6witD3KphQ31BaEsR1
transaction
6e666fb26a92c212dfdfd084da8806213fd3c419043d3eaa615eae9475e77fea
spent
true